✨ GET TO KNOW WHAT YOU WANT
This is a core principle in coaching. It’s quite hard to acknowledge what we really want. I mean, we all somewhat know what we want, but if we look closer, usually we’ll notice that those desires are quite vague and not specific, more in form of a dream and not in the form of goals. And thus they’re quite unachievable. How can you achieve something so unspecific when it’s not clear what you really want? In my future posts I’ll cover the aspects of goal setting and tell you what are the principles of efficient goal setting.
So, in order to clearly understand what it is you want Marie Kondo suggests to really visualize the result. You want uncluttered house? What does it mean for you? How it’ll look like when your house is uncluttered? Will it have some specific scents? Will you want to enjoy some specific activities there? What do you want?
If you really can’t just understand and imagine what exactly you want and how it’ll look like – you can get inspired by some photos on hte Internet or specialized magazines, as well as you can go to some furniture stores and explore what’s exciting there. ✨ TAKE SOME TIME TO UNDERSTAND WHY YOU WANT IT
Now you’d think it’s enough of preparation and it’s time to go and clean everything up. But no, here comes the best and most valuable part. You should take some time and with no rush listen to yourself and understand why it is exactly that you want all this? And when you get your answer – even then it’s not enough. You should ask yourself once again: “Okay, and for what purposes would I want this”? And so on for at least 3-5 times.
Actually, in business management it’s called FIVE WHY technique.
In business world it’s mostly used to understand the real problem. For example:
You identify a problem and then ask “Okay, and why this problem occurred?”
Then you find an answer for your question, like another problem, and then ask: “Good, and why then this other problem occurred?” And like this for at least five WHY questions.
This is done in order to get to that real reason why you want it (or why the problem occurred). The trick is that only that TRUE reason drives you to real long-term actions.
What we usually do is to try and get motivated by those surface reasons which usually just won’t work. But when you get to your deep and valuable motivators, then everything is done just easier and with more fun. And the best part – IT WORKS!
